r>Make sure you could have the proper dress, shoes, and more to look good on the massive day. The quality and texture of the fabric positively issues. There are nonetheless a big variety of choices including lace, organza, taffeta, and thick duchess satin. Conversely, avoid fabrics which are skinny and clingy, such as chiffon, or satin weave, also referred to as charmeuse. However, the skinny supplies work fantastic for accents or overlays. It presents all forms of clothes, sneakers, handbags, jewelry, and equipment from luxurious brands. Katharine Polk is an LA-based designer dedicated to main an ethical and sustainable enterprise. She specializes in custom, made-to-order wedding apparel that is stylish, inclusive, and produced regionally in Los Angeles. Polk's designs combine clear, minimalist materials with playful particulars, like statement sleeves and draped backs. To help make her clothes accessible, this eco-conscious designer offers quite a lot of price factors and sizes 00-30.
